dc.description | Extraction of potassium ion from an alkaline source phase containing high concentration of sodium ion through a chloroform phase facilitated by the lipophilic carrier crown ether 2-sym-(dibenzo-19-crown-6-oxy) decanoic acid was studied at 298 K by bulk liquid membrane and by liquid surfactant membrane experiments. Differences in the transport rate and efficiency were observed and discussed for the two separation techniques. | |
